Even the few that do, such as California, Virginia, and Colorado, have a relatively narrow focus or weak enforcement provisions. It would regulate bigger companies' standard data practices, like the collection and use of our browsing history to deliver targeted ads. It would also give us data portability rights, allowing us to take our data to a competitor if we want to switch services.
